Prevalence and incidence of diabetic peripheral neuropathy in Latin America and the Caribbean: A systematic review and meta-analysis.

Marlon Yovera-AldanaVictor Velásquez-RimachiAndrely Huerta-RosarioM D More-YupanquiMariela Osores-FloresRicardo EspinozaFradis Gil-OlivaresCésar Quispe-NolazcoFlor Quea-VélezChristian Morán-MariñosIsabel Pinedo-TorresCarlos Alva-DiazKevin Pacheco-Barrios
Published in: PloS one (2021)
The overall prevalence of DPN is high in LAC with significant heterogeneity between and within countries that could be explained by population type and methodological aspects. Significant gaps (e.g., under-representation of most countries, lack of incidence studies, and heterogenous case definition) were identified. Standardized and population-based studies of DPN in LAC are needed.
